Aspen Medical Practice in Gloucester is looking for an administrator to join their supportive team in a busy doctors’ surgery. The role involves sorting mail, clinical coding, summarising patient records, and managing references.
The ideal candidate will possess strong organisational skills and attention to detail, preferably with experience in healthcare environments. Full training will be provided. The role supports various administrative tasks essential for patient care.
Benefits include free parking and access to the NHS pension scheme.
